An official SAT score report is required by most of the colleges which are sent directly from the College Board. To send SAT score free to universities consider the following points :
The candidate who aspires to pursue an undergraduate course should register themselves on the College Board for the SAT test. The registered students need to sign up to send SAT scores for free and they can send up to 4 FREE Score Reports.
After logging in to your College Board account, choose the option “send score” in order to share your score with the selected universities for free.
The student can choose the “send available score now” option if he/she wishes to send their score right away, otherwise, they can choose the “send scores when available” option, if they are registered for an upcoming test.
The offer of sending a FREE SAT Score is available from the day of registration up to 9 days after the SAT test date. The students in India are allowed to send unlimited scores for free to any India Global Alliance member universities in India.
The test scores are released officially within 6 – 10 weeks from the test date and the score report is sent to the colleges within 10 days after the official announcement of SAT score by the College Board.
There is no need to hurry, take your time and choose the universities wisely otherwise, you will have to pay an additional fee for choosing another university after the 9-day period.
